Before beginning to decorate, be sure that your chocolate cupcakes are cool to the touch. Decorating when they’re warm will cause the frosting to melt and slip off – drooly frosting is not good! Let ’em cool completely.
Using an electric mixer, beat softened butter, icing sugar and milk altogether until smooth.
Color the frosting with green gel food coloring and mix on high until completely tinted.
Using a piping bag, dot around the circumference of each cupcake, making two rows of pom-poms around the outside of the cupcake.
Roll fondant into ½ inch spheres and then shape into 12 little stars. You can easily do this by flattening the spheres then creating indents into the side. For sharper points for stars, you can use the edge of a cookie cutter, scissor, knife, etc.
Place one star on each cupcake.
Add your multi-colored candies and serve. Enjoy and happy holidays!
